A property styling consultation is not simply about choosing furniture or colours, it’s about developing a vision that aligns with your home’s strengths and the preferences of potential buyers.
The consultation allows the stylist to assess your property, understand your selling goals, and discuss styling options that best fit your target market. The objective is to create a look that enhances the property’s appeal while helping it stand out in Melbourne’s competitive real estate market.
During this meeting, your stylist gathers all the information needed to create a styling plan that highlights your home’s key features and ensures that every detail contributes to a positive buyer impression.
The process usually begins with a conversation about your property, your selling timeline, and your expectations. Your stylist will ask questions to understand your goals, whether you’re aiming for a quick sale, a higher price, or both.
You’ll also discuss practical details such as your budget, the current state of your property, and whether it’s vacant or occupied. The stylist may also ask about your target buyer demographic, families, professionals, or investors, to tailor the design to their lifestyle and preferences.

Next comes the property assessment. The stylist will walk through your home, room by room, taking detailed notes and photographs. They’ll evaluate the space, lighting, colour scheme, flooring, and layout.
This hands-on review helps them identify what works, what needs improvement, and how to make the most of the property’s existing features. For instance, they may suggest rearranging furniture to enhance space, adding soft furnishings for warmth, or introducing statement pieces to create visual interest.
This step also helps the stylist determine which furniture and décor will be required for the final styling. It’s a detailed process designed to ensure that every design decision contributes to a cohesive, attractive presentation.
After the walk-through, your stylist will provide professional recommendations based on their observations. These might include suggestions for paint colours, lighting adjustments, decluttering tips, and minor repairs to improve presentation.
They’ll also explain how different design styles, modern, coastal, contemporary, or classic, can work for your home and target market. The aim is to balance aesthetics with function, ensuring that your home feels inviting and aspirational without losing its practicality.
At this stage, the stylist may show you visual examples, sample fabrics, or mood boards to help you envision the final result. This collaborative approach ensures that the design aligns with your preferences while appealing to a broad range of potential buyers.
Once the stylist has gathered all the necessary information, they’ll prepare a detailed proposal outlining the scope of work, inclusions, and costs. This quotation will typically include furniture hire, delivery, installation, styling, and pack-up services after the sale.
You’ll receive a clear timeline of the process, from preparation to final styling day. Transparency is key here; the stylist ensures you understand what’s covered in the quote and what additional services might be available.

Once you approve the proposal, the stylist will coordinate the next steps, including booking delivery dates, scheduling installation, and confirming the styling timeline.
You’ll also receive guidance on how to prepare your property before styling day. This may involve decluttering, completing minor maintenance, or removing personal items to create a neutral and inviting canvas for buyers.
The stylist ensures that the entire process is smooth and well-organised, keeping you informed at every stage.
